It is a bit of an interesting quandary for Kranaukhov if he has a choice between Belarus and Russia.

Recall that once he plays for one of these countries at an IIHF sanctioned tournament he is pretty much locked into that country for future IIHF tournaments (World Championships, Olympics, etc). There is a way to switch to another country later on his hockey career but it is a lot of red tape/time involved and you can only switch to another country once.


On one hand, if he plays for Belarus, he likely gets a lot of ice time and will be counted as one of the leaders for that team. However, Belarus isn't exactly a hockey power and likely won't go far in tournaments, but he should be able to get on future teams relatively easy.

On the other hand, if he plays for Russia, he likely goes deep into hockey tournaments getting experience. However, Russia has a lot better and deeper talent pool than Belarus so his ice time might be limited behind other players and it will be harder to make future teams.
